Pivot Table is a macro bundled within Table Filter and Charts for Confluence add-on. It allows you to create pivot tables with aggregated and summarized data on the basis of repeated values from the source table.
Parameters
The add-on adds the Pivot table macro. You can add this macro onto your Confluence page and further paste any table into the macro body. You can also insert the macros that generate the table data and get a pivot table with aggregated values. The following parameters are available to you:
Parameter | Parameter Name | Default | Description |
---|---|---|---|
column | Row Labels | The column that contains row labels that will be grouped into a pivot table. | |
aggregation | Calculated Column | The column with data values that will be processed according to the selected operation type. | |
decimals | Decimal places | Number of decimal places in data values. | |
decimalseparator | Decimal separator | Point (.) | The sign used as a decimal separator. |
id | Macro ID | Assigned automatically | ID of the macro in Confluence. |
type | Operation Type | Count | Type of the operation that is performed on data values containing in the Calculated Column. |
separator | Thousands separator | The sign that is used as a thousands separator. | |
showrawdata | Show the source table | False | Option that enables display of the source table data used for generation of the pivot table. |
hidePane | Hide control panel | False | Option that hides the control panel for management of the pivot table. |

You can use the dedicated panel to change the calculated column and select the appropriate operation type from the following ones:
- Count - counts the number of values pertaining to one label in the source table.
- Max - determines the maximal value per each label.
- Min - determines the minimal value per each label.
- Average - calculates the average values per each label.
- Sum - calculates the sum of values per each label.
